Rank / ISS
The image-based structural similarity (ISS) metric measures the Euclidean distance between the image-based feature vectors for the query instance and all other instances. A smaller ISS value indicates greater similarity.
|
1 / 1.061 | 2 / 1.070 | 3 / 1.078 | 4 / 1.078 | 5 / 1.082 | |

Instance Summary
The table below contains summary information for neos-578379, the five most similar instances to neos-578379 according to the MIC, and the five most similar instances to neos-578379 according to MIPLIB 2017.
INSTANCE | SUBMITTER | DESCRIPTION | ISS | RANK | |
---|---|---|---|---|---|
Parent Instance | neos-578379 [MIPLIB] | NEOS Server Submission | Imported from the MIPLIB2010 submissions. | 0.000000 | - |
MIC Top 5 | qnet1 [MIPLIB] | MIPLIB submission pool | Imported from the MIPLIB2010 submissions. | 1.061267 | 1 |
fhnw-binschedule1 [MIPLIB] | Simon Felix | Scheduling/assignment for an industrial production pipeline | 1.069635 | 2 | |
neos-2991472-kalu [MIPLIB] | Jeff Linderoth | (None provided) | 1.077718 | 3 | |
d20200 [MIPLIB] | COR@L test set | Instance coming from the COR@L test set with unknown origin | 1.078008 | 4 | |
pg [MIPLIB] | M. Dawande | Multiproduct partial shipment model | 1.081827 | 5 | |
